Frequently Asked Questions about Wappingers Falls
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Wappingers Falls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Wappingers Falls ranges from $1,153 to $3,100 with an average monthly rent of $2,137.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Wappingers Falls c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Wappingers Falls range from $1,383 to $3,650.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,609.
How expensive are Wappingers Falls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 24 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Wappingers Falls on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,599 to $3,395 - averaging $2,681 for the location.
